How they compare
Saint Lucia currently reports 7.2% against 2.7% in Lower middle income, a difference of 4.5%.
That makes Saint Lucia's figure about 2.6 times Lower middle income's.
The two have swapped places 30 times across 48 shared years of data; in 1978 it was Saint Lucia ahead.
Lower middle income ranks 28th and Saint Lucia ranks 31st of 46 groups.
Across the 6 decades both report, Lower middle income averaged higher in 4 and Saint Lucia in 2.

About this data
Agriculture, forestry, and fishing corresponds to ISIC (Rev. 4) divisions 01-03 and includes the exploitation of vegetal and animal natural resources, comprising the activities of growing of crops, raising and breeding of animals, harvesting of timber and other plants, animals or animal products from a farm or their natural habitats.Value added is the contribution to the economy by a producer or an industry or an institutional sector, which is estimated by the total value of output produced and deducting the total value of intermediate consumption of goods and services used to produce that output. This indicator denotes the percentage change over each previous year of the constant price (base year 2015) series in United States dollars.
